pub struct Compound<N>{ /* private fields */ }Expand description
A compound shape with an aabb bounding volume.
A compound shape is a shape composed of the union of several simpler shape. This is the main way of creating a concave shape from convex parts. Each parts can have its own delta transformation to shift or rotate it with regard to the other shapes.
